RCMP Drug Unit investigation leads to an arrest
In the Fall of 2022, the St. Albert RCMP Drug Unit, with the assistance of the St. Albert Crime Reduction Unit, started a Methamphetamine and Fentanyl trafficking investigation. On November 4, 2022, the drug investigation led to the arrest of Eric Angers (42), a resident of St. Albert.
Eric Angers was charged with:
- Possession for the purpose of Trafficking Methamphetamine
- Possession for the purpose of Trafficking Fentanyl
Eric Angers was also wanted on the following outstanding warrants:
- Canada Wide Parole Warrant
- Trafficking Methamphetamine X 2
- Possession of Property obtained by Crime
As a result of the drug arrest, the outstanding warrants were executed. Eric Angers was remanded in custody and will appear in St. Albert Provincial Court on January 9, 2023.
